Contact printed. how to “To build or not to build” this is the question. Certainly one could simply replace a lens on any number of cameras. With a thin sheet of aluminum pie tin, a small amount of tape and a needle to open the appropriate aperture, image making is within grasp. Conversely, oatmeal boxes, candy tins, suitcases, and red peppers surely pop into mind as alternatives to commercially produced cameras that may indeed lend more to the nature of the process.
